What is everyone's favorite way to roll the motor forward to get to the back 3 plugs? I have large hands. Thanks.
I disconnect the front motor mounts and push the dogbones down towards the base of the motor, then I put a ratchet strap from the radiator support, around the top of the engine to the other side. That way you can ratchet the motor as far forward as you need to.
There are holes near the dogbones on the radiator support which should be perfect for the hooks of the ratchet strap.

Thanks, do you put the transmission in nuetral?
You don't have to, but it rocks forward further if you do.
